[REGNUM] The frigate of the Northern Fleet (SF) "Admiral Gorshkov", which is equipped with hypersonic missiles "Zirkon", in 2023 for the first time will lead the permanent task force of the Russian Navy in the Mediterranean Sea. On December 30, a source close to the Russian military department told about this. ![]() According to him, cited by TASS, the named frigate should go to sea in January 2023. "Kursk" was already taken "He will solve the tasks of combat duty in the Mediterranean Sea, having Zircon hypersonic missiles on board," the source said. He also added that such an event would be the first in the history of the Russian Navy. At the same time, it is clarified that the agency does not have official confirmation of such information. As REGNUM reported , on December 29, Russian President Vladimir Putin congratulated the sailors of the Russian Navy and shipbuilders on the commissioning of new warships. |
